Difference between European Coal and Steel Community and Languages of the European Union

European Coal and Steel Community vs. Languages of the European Union

The European Coal and Steel Community (ECSC) was an organisation of 6 European countries set up after World War II to regulate their industrial production under a centralised authority. The languages of the European Union are languages used by people within the member states of the European Union (EU).
